Gas Prices Dip Under $3 In The Twin Cities

MINNEAPOLIS (WCCO) -- Gas prices continue to drop in the Twin Cities.

We found gas prices under three bucks a gallon in the Twin Cities overnight -- for the first time in months.

The price of gas was $2.99 at Smart Stop on Johnson Street Northeast in Minneapolis.

About a half dozen stations across the metro were below $3 Tuesday morning and many weren't much higher.

The statewide average is $3.18 a gallon.

AAA said that's down 10 cents from this time last week.

The national average for Tuesday is $3.28 a gallon.

Last month, we hit 1,000 days since the national average was below three bucks a gallon.
